数据库用户是什么
-
数据库用户是具有特定权限和访问数据库的能力的个人、程序或进程。数据库用户通常有自己的用户名和密码,以便在数据库系统中进行身份验证和访问控制。以下是关于数据库用户的一些重要信息:
-
身份验证和访问控制:数据库用户需要经过身份验证,通常使用用户名和密码进行登录。一旦成功登录,用户可以根据其权限级别执行各种数据库操作,例如查询、插入、更新和删除数据,创建和管理表,以及执行存储过程等。
-
用户权限和角色:数据库用户可以具有不同的权限级别,这取决于他们在数据库中的角色和权限分配。管理员可以创建具有特定权限的用户角色,然后将这些角色分配给不同的用户,从而简化权限管理并确保安全性。
-
数据安全性:数据库用户的身份验证和访问控制是确保数据安全性的重要组成部分。通过限制用户的访问权限,数据库管理员可以防止未经授权的访问和不当使用数据,从而保护敏感信息免受不法分子的侵害。
-
数据完整性:数据库用户还可以通过执行特定的操作来维护数据的完整性,例如确保表中的数据符合特定的约束条件,以及执行事务以确保一致性和持久性。
-
数据管理:除了访问和操作数据之外,数据库用户还可以对数据库进行管理任务,例如备份和恢复数据,监控数据库性能,进行优化和索引管理等。
总的来说,数据库用户是数据库系统中具有特定权限和访问能力的个人或实体,他们通过身份验证和访问控制机制与数据库交互,从而实现数据的安全、完整性和有效管理。
1年前 -
-
数据库用户是指被授予访问数据库的权限和特权的个体或实体。在数据库管理系统中,用户是指具有独立身份和独特标识的个体或应用程序。数据库用户可以是人类用户,也可以是代表特定应用程序或系统进程的实体。数据库用户一般通过用户名和密码来进行身份验证并进行数据库操作。
数据库用户通常被赋予以下权限和特权:
-
数据库访问权限:通过授予用户对特定数据库或数据库对象(如表、视图、存储过程等)的访问权限,用户可以查询、插入、更新和删除数据。
-
系统特权:某些数据库用户可能被授予管理数据库系统的特权,例如创建和管理其他用户,管理存储空间,执行备份和恢复操作等。
-
数据库对象权限:数据库用户可以被授予对特定数据库对象的特定权限,如 SELECT、INSERT、UPDATE、DELETE 等,以控制其对数据的操作权限。
-
会话管理:数据库用户可以创建和管理与数据库的会话,包括登录、退出、会话参数设置等操作。
除了以上提到的权限外,数据库用户还可能受到数据库管理员定义的其他安全策略和限制。数据库用户的管理通常由数据库管理员负责,包括创建、修改、删除用户,以及管理他们的访问权限和特权。数据库用户的存在和管理有助于保障数据库的安全性、完整性和可追溯性。
1年前 -
-
数据库用户是指被赋予在数据库系统中执行特定操作的个人、程序或应用程序。具体来说,数据库用户通常被用来控制对数据库的访问和操作,以便确保数据的安全性、一致性和完整性。
数据库用户通常具有以下作用和特点:
-
权限控制:数据库用户可以被分配不同的权限,例如读取、写入、更新和删除数据的操作。这样可以确保只有经过授权的用户才能对数据库中的数据进行操作。
-
身份识别:每个数据库用户都有一个唯一的标识符,通常是用户名或者用户ID。这个标识符用于识别数据库中的特定用户,并确定其被允许执行的操作。
-
数据所有权:数据库用户可以被授予对特定数据对象(如表、视图、存储过程等)的所有权,这意味着他们有权对这些对象进行操作,包括修改、删除和共享数据。
-
安全性管理:数据库用户还可以用于实施安全策略,例如使用角色和权限来限制对敏感数据的访问,或者监控对数据库的访问和操作。
创建数据库用户一般需要经过以下几个步骤:
-
用户身份认证:通常通过用户名和密码的形式进行,有些数据库系统还支持其他方式的身份认证,比如操作系统身份验证、证书认证等。
-
用户授权:一旦用户的身份得到认证,数据库管理员可以为该用户分配特定的权限和角色,以便确定他们可访问的数据库对象和所能进行的操作。
-
用户管理:数据库管理员需要负责管理数据库用户,包括创建、修改、删除用户,以及监控用户的活动并确保他们的安全性。
1年前 -


